首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

RESTful Web服务使用PHP登录

RESTful Web服务是一种基于HTTP协议的软件架构风格,用于构建可扩展的分布式系统。它通过使用统一的接口和无状态的通信方式,使得不同的客户端可以通过HTTP协议进行交互。

PHP是一种流行的服务器端脚本语言,适用于Web开发。它具有易学易用的特点,并且有丰富的开发资源和社区支持。

使用PHP登录RESTful Web服务的过程如下:

  1. 客户端发送登录请求到服务器端。
  2. 服务器端接收到请求后,验证用户提供的登录信息。
  3. 如果验证成功,服务器端生成一个访问令牌(Token),并将其返回给客户端。
  4. 客户端在后续的请求中携带该访问令牌,以便进行身份验证和授权。
  5. 服务器端在接收到后续请求时,验证访问令牌的有效性,并根据权限进行相应的操作。

RESTful Web服务使用PHP登录的优势包括:

  1. 简单易用:PHP具有简洁的语法和丰富的开发资源,使得登录功能的实现变得简单易用。
  2. 跨平台兼容:PHP可以运行在多个操作系统上,包括Windows、Linux等,可以满足不同平台的需求。
  3. 可扩展性:RESTful架构的特点使得系统具有良好的可扩展性,可以方便地添加新的功能和服务。
  4. 开发效率高:PHP具有丰富的开发框架和工具,可以提高开发效率,减少开发成本。

RESTful Web服务使用PHP登录的应用场景包括:

  1. 网站用户登录:用户可以通过提供用户名和密码进行登录,以便访问个人信息和执行相应的操作。
  2. 第三方应用接入:其他应用可以通过登录接口获取访问令牌,以便访问用户的数据和执行相应的操作。
  3. 身份验证和授权:通过登录接口验证用户的身份,并根据权限进行相应的授权操作。

腾讯云提供了一系列与PHP开发相关的产品和服务,包括:

  1. 云服务器(CVM):提供可扩展的虚拟服务器,适用于部署PHP应用程序。
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的MySQL数据库服务,适用于存储用户信息和登录凭证。
  3. API网关(API Gateway):提供API管理和发布服务,可以用于构建RESTful Web服务的接口。
  4. 腾讯云函数(SCF):提供无服务器计算服务,可以用于处理登录请求和生成访问令牌。
  5. 腾讯云对象存储(COS):提供高可靠、低成本的对象存储服务,适用于存储用户上传的文件和数据。

更多关于腾讯云产品和服务的信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

12分20秒

015 尚硅谷-Linux云计算-网络服务-基础-windows使用密钥对登录试验

9分43秒

10分钟手把手教你通过SSH,使用密钥/账号远程登录Linux服务器(Windows/macOS)

4分47秒

【go-web】第一讲-web服务器

7分57秒

docker搭建集群之NGINX多服务。

17.6K
6分10秒

玩转dnmp(一)配置NGINX

7分32秒

37、尚硅谷_SpringBoot_web开发-【实验】-Restful实验要求.avi

33秒

Cloud Studio简易深度学习案列(仅此而已

13分23秒

威联通NAS使用Container搭建Minecraft(我的世界)服务器,带网页管理面板

23.3K
7分5秒

云上远程开发Node.js应用

16分34秒

51、尚硅谷_SpringBoot_web开发-使用外部Servlet容器&JSP支持.avi

1分39秒

华汇数据WEB页面性能监控中心,实时发现页面错误

14分53秒

15分钟演示手动编译安装Nginx和PHP将树莓派/服务器变为自己的小型NAS、下载站

1.4K
领券